AWS Snowball Edge is a petabyte-scale data transport service with onboard storage and compute capabilities.

AWS Snowball Edge is a petabyte-scale data transport service with onboard storage and compute capabilities. This course introduces you to the service by providing an overview of its features and functionality, a detailed discussion of how AWS Snowball Edge works, and a review of potential use cases and case studies.
